Output cd565343db3ee1b9b61760677752556b01401f95f417d0e84b0252d00a3a61e7:0

value
5125066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908b792e6f971e87611b9165c59bf10cad726f5c OP_EQUAL
address
3EsJJwrexeCqh6EHAhpQcZ5Dhx7KHpzLih
transaction
cd565343db3ee1b9b61760677752556b01401f95f417d0e84b0252d00a3a61e7
spent
true